How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Rogers Park?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Rogers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,212 | $1,200 | $1,250 |
Rogers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,676 | $1,395 | $1,985 |
Rogers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,958 | $1,505 | $2,470 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Rogers Park
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Rogers Park c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Rogers Park range from $1,395 to $1,985.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,676.
